Can (b. 1991, Istanbul) is a visual artist working across film, photography, and graphic design.
In 2026, he co-directed a short documentary with Teva Cheema, about an upside-down car that sits untouched for weeks on a quiet street.
Also in 2026, he made short film about two brothers getting lost. This one is currently in post-production.
In 2024, he made a short film about a French-Turkish actress who tries to spend time with her dad.
In 2023 he made a film made of some photos taken by his dad. The two comment on these photos.
Also in 2023, he shot a film about three trees that act as his mom, dad and himself respectively. They talk about clouds, stars and a jackal that’s been visiting their garden.
In 2017, he started his MA Filmmaking studies at London Film School, where he shot a 3-min film about a man who, unlike his dad, doesn’t have a fear of heights.
In 2026 he made an interview with Agnès Godard (Beau Travail, Sister) on her views about Yılmaz Güney’s absence in Wim Wenders’ 1982 film Room 666.
These are Can’s personal films.
